Back to Basics: PB Ratio


Riot Platforms  (NAS:RIOT) PB Ratio Explanation

Unlike valuation ratios relative to the earning power such as PE Ratio, PE Ratio without NRI, PS Ratio, Price-to-Operating-Cash-Flow , or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, the PB Ratio measures the valuation of the stock relative to the underlying asset of the company.

The PB Ratio works the best for the businesses that earn most of their profit from their assets, e.g. banks and insurance companies.


Be Aware

Some businesses have very light assets, such as software companies or insurance agencies. The PB Ratio does not work well for these companies. Some companies even have negative equity, so the PB Ratio cannot be applied to them.

Riot Platforms Business Description

Address 3855 Ambrosia Street, Suite 301, Castle Rock, CO, USA, 80109
Riot Platforms Inc is a vertically integrated digital infrastructure company principally engaged in developing and optimizing its large-scale power assets. The Company's business centers on enhancing its electrical infrastructure and deploying it across two complementary platforms: (i) Bitcoin Mining and (ii) scalable data center solutions designed to support non-mining workloads. The company's segments include Bitcoin Mining and Engineering. The Bitcoin Mining segment generates revenue from the Bitcoin the Company earns through its Bitcoin Mining activities. The Engineering segment generates revenue through customer contracts for custom engineered electrical products. It generates the majority of its revenue from the Bitcoin Mining segment.
